What does waiting period mean for dental supplementary insurance?

The waiting period is the time between taking out the policy and when benefits start. Many insurers use waiting periods to ensure policies are not taken out only immediately before planned treatment.

Depending on the plan, this period can last several months. Some insurers waive waiting periods entirely or offer shorter periods.

Which benefits can be covered without a waiting period?

With plans without a waiting period, certain benefits may apply immediately after the contract starts. These often include:

Dental prophylaxis

Services such as professional dental cleaning or preventive check-ups.

Dental treatments

Treatments such as fillings or other medically necessary measures.

Dental prostheses

Depending on the plan, prosthetic benefits may also start earlier.

Which benefits are covered immediately depends on the respective plan.

How much does dental supplementary insurance without a waiting period cost?

Premiums depend on several factors. These include entry age, the condition of your teeth and the scope of the plan.

Many plans start at about €10–20 per month. Stronger plans may have higher premiums but offer more comprehensive benefits.
